What Happens During a Dental Exam?

Dental exams typically happen before a professional cleaning. Your dental hygienist will take a physical examination of your entire mouth to make sure nothing is out of the ordinary. They will use a small mirror to check for signs of gingivitis or other concerns. During the dental exam, we look at your teeth and around your gums.

What Happens During a Dental Cleaning?

A gentle dental cleaning can freshen your breath and remove built-up plaque from your teeth. First, a hygienist will use a scraping tool to remove plaque and tartar from around the gum line. Next, they will use a gritty toothpaste and a high-powered electric toothbrush to gently scrub your teeth and remove any tartar that’s been left behind.

Your hygienist will also floss your teeth and rinse your mouth to eliminate any debris. Getting this professional cleaning done twice a year can ensure your mouth is as healthy as can be.

Benefits of Exams and Cleanings

Dental exams and cleanings are important parts of your routine visits. These treatments professionally clean your teeth and gums and prevent other issues like decay from occurring.

Other advantages include:

  • Early detection of diseases
  • Disease prevention
  • Addresses minor issues quickly
  • A chance to learn proper oral hygiene techniques
